UPDATE: Here's the turret primed only in black. I will probably color it, but for now, it suits my purposes. The launchers were made from two gluestick tubes, the ramp and base were made from the command hangar. I ripped it apart to give my self two flat bases, one for the bottom and the other for a solid ramp, then used part of the curved plastic to build the pivot. Let me know what you guys think! After parts, about $5, I saved about $10-15 versus buying a new turret/a whole new whirlwind.
